Patient's Query

Hello doctor,

My son is 1.8 years old. He is not munching the food. He is just swallowing food very difficultly. Food will not touch his teeth too. When he was eight months, I started to give all foods in pure form. I will grind all the vegetables and rice to give him. I feel like there I started my mistake. When he was 1-year-old, I began to give in solid form.

But he is not munching just swallowing it. I have to mash all the solids foods with hand and give. Kindly help me. I am very worried about him. He fears too much, even for the biscuit. He will try to eat a cookie, but he will put it down then. Kindly let me know what should I do. He is not eating any snacks and chappathi. Always this is going in my mind. Please help.

Hello,

Welcome to icliniq.com.

This is typical behavior in this age group, which will change as you teach your kid. But we need to rule out is there any problem with the dentition and tongue.

1. Meet your family doctor to check for any dental problems or tongue tie or oral problems.

2. Continue the same type of food. Gradually give one item at a time for a week then the next item gives semisolid food, then solid foods, reduce the number of liquid food items continuously.

3. Do not worry, he will learn.
